Therapeutic Approaches and Online Care with Erika Rucker
Attachment-Based Therapy explores how early relationships shape current patterns of connection and trust, helping clients address abandonment, attachment issues, and relationship dynamics by strengthening emotional bonds and improving communication.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es empathy, acceptance, and collaboration; the therapist follows the client's lead to create a supportive environment that fosters self-discovery and personal growth, which can be helpful for self-esteem, life transitions, and coping challenges.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on the link between thoughts, emotions, and behaviors, offering practical tools to reduce symptoms of anxiety, depression, and stress and to build healthier routines and coping skills.
